Archives are refreshed every 30 minutes - for details, please visit
the main index
.
You can also
download the archives in mbox format
.
demexp-cvs (date)
[
Thread Index
][
Top
][
All Lists
]
Advanced
[
Prev Period
]
Last Modified: Thu Oct 30 2003 16:46:46 -0500
Messages in reverse chronological order
[
Next Period
]
October 30, 2003
[Demexp-cvs] Added delegation removal (tested).
,
David Mentré
,
16:46
October 27, 2003
[Demexp-cvs] Updated README with urls of needed external software. Code cosmetic change on lists to follow OCaml program formatting guidelines.
,
David Mentré
,
17:13
[Demexp-cvs] Updated README for missing compilation dependencies. Correct handling of delegation: when an individual delegates a domain, all of its votes over the domain are canceled (tested). Added some autotests on delegated votes: it seems to work. :)
,
David Mentré
,
16:53
October 26, 2003
[Demexp-cvs] We now check that we can't vote on a delegated question (tested). Rennaming of Posbase.Hidden into Individual.
,
David Mentré
,
10:37
[Demexp-cvs] Renaming of Posbase.position_base into the_position_base (as in other modules). Moved code from computing vote results from Work to Posbase module. After a new delegation, all votes are recomputed (NOT tested).
,
David Mentré
,
09:56
[Demexp-cvs] Updated module Classification with functions to get the classification from a question (tested). In Participants and Posbase, delegates and individuals are authenticated as Authenticated_delegate or Authenticated_individual. Posbase.weight_of_vote_author should now handle classification (NOT tested). YAETF: godess -> goddess.
,
David Mentré
,
09:08
October 25, 2003
[Demexp-cvs] Re-enabled all autotests from dummy client.
,
David Mentré
,
04:47
October 23, 2003
[Demexp-cvs] Renaming of path_to_bit_vector into path_and_subpaths_to_bit_vector (Classification). Addition of Classification.path_to_bit_vector, Classification.classification_overlap and Classification.classification_equal. Also classification_to_string. Addition of reverse hash-table in classification, from keyword_id |-> keyword entry. Complete rewrite of Delegation: we are now using bit vectors (Dbitv module) instead of classification_path. Addition of Fred and Felix in the Thank You. Code in module Work not updated yet.
,
David Mentré
,
16:03
October 18, 2003
[Demexp-cvs] Yet Another English Typo Fix
,
David Mentré
,
13:34
[Demexp-cvs] Added a keyword_id for each keyword in Classification. Added transformation of classification path to bit vector (tested). Added Dbitv.resize_set: set a bit in a bit vector and resize it if necessary (tested).
,
David Mentré
,
13:29
[Demexp-cvs] Update of Classification documentation on internal working (corresponding code does not exists yet). Reorganization of the_classification_base: use records.
,
David Mentré
,
12:23
[Demexp-cvs] Added Dbitv module: Dynamically resizable Bit Vectors.
,
David Mentré
,
11:04
[Demexp-cvs] some clarifications in doc. Rewriting of is_terminal_delegate. Commit before the Big Changes(tm)
,
David Mentré
,
07:03
October 13, 2003
[Demexp-cvs] When adding a new Participant, if its name starts with 'delegate_' then he is a delegate (tested). We now check on a new delegation that the delegate and the delegated domain both exist (tested).
,
David Mentré
,
14:04
October 12, 2003
[Demexp-cvs] Handling of delegation request (not fully tested). Delegation does NOT work: too many things are currently missing. Addition of kind (Individual or Delegate) into the Participants base.
,
David Mentré
,
15:24
[Demexp-cvs] Handling of requests to list keywords and questions under a given path (tested).
,
David Mentré
,
13:09
[Demexp-cvs] New questions are now classified (tested). We can add new keywords in the Classification (tested).
,
David Mentré
,
12:28
October 11, 2003
[Demexp-cvs] Added classification base (documented and tested). Added Todo section.
,
David Mentré
,
06:36
October 10, 2003
[Demexp-cvs] Handling of new participant addition (tested).
,
David Mentré
,
15:08
October 09, 2003
[Demexp-cvs] Added Savannah and OCaml people to thank you. YAETF (Yet Another English Typo Fix): Hiden -> Hidden. Added helper functions to compute vote winner in Voting module. Storing of vote updates the winning responses (tested), however the delegation is not taken into account yet.
,
David Mentré
,
15:48
October 06, 2003
[Demexp-cvs] Handling of votes (tested). The computation of votes is not done, however. Wrote description of Position base data structure and rewrote description of check_vote. Changed Anonymized (not English) into Hiden (English). Added missing autotests to Posbase.
,
David Mentré
,
18:04
[Demexp-cvs] Handling of request of details on a question (tested). Cosmetic rename of variables in Work module. Use another typing for message_sequence for better clarity. Network login 'anonymous' (as a string) corresponds to the internal Anonymous.
,
David Mentré
,
16:06
October 05, 2003
[Demexp-cvs] added some missing description for handle_add_response.
,
David Mentré
,
13:17
[Demexp-cvs] In messages.xdr.nw, renamed 'choice' into 'response' and 'generic_response' into 'generic_reply'. Added server code to add a new response to a question (tested). Added some more logs on previously coded operations by the server.
,
David Mentré
,
11:48
[Demexp-cvs] Fix in messages: goodbye_client and goodbye_server messages don't have an argument. Handling of messages that should not be received by the server. Added Norman Ramsey of noweb fame in the Thank you part. Reworked testing infrastructure in dummy_client. Handling on server of question creation (quickly tested).
,
David Mentré
,
10:19
[Demexp-cvs] Made autotests of client login. Moved dummy_client part relative to server testing into the Work module. Improved cross-referencing to code chunks in produced documentation.
,
David Mentré
,
07:24
October 04, 2003
[Demexp-cvs] Added Participants autotests. Rewrote server handling of clients in a synchronous way. Wrote server code to handle login message (not tested). Defined the default database as containing an administrator.
,
David Mentré
,
18:07
[Demexp-cvs] Fixed typo: "authentified" is not English, "authenticated" is. Introduced the base of participants and related functions to manipulate it.
,
David Mentré
,
16:22
October 02, 2003
[Demexp-cvs] Added Gerd's explanation on XDR encoding/decoding. Added autotest code for the socket part of the server. Refined server network code.
,
David Mentré
,
17:18
October 01, 2003
[Demexp-cvs] added Work module that will process requests from network clients.
,
David Mentré
,
23:10
[Demexp-cvs] added threading code. Several workers can handle remote clients simultaneously. Code not tested. Due to lack of locking, only limited to one client right now.
,
David Mentré
,
17:37
[
Prev Period
]
[
Next Period
]
Mail converted by
MHonArc